New Auction - 03/06/06 - Maelstrom

March 7th, 2006 · 1 Comment

Just one new auction today, Maelstrom.

I really like this set, the colors turned out quite nice and the flowing swirls worked very well with the depth of the transparent glass. These are the first round round beads I’ve made, they’re almost marble-like in their roundness and it is a shape I really find myself enjoying.
